Since the last firefox update pages have been displaying in a buggy manner. It is difficult to read most pages, submitting this bug is even difficult!
I have attached some images since I have no idea how to describe the problem. After taking the screenshots the display goes normal until I scroll up or down. I can often fix the problem in a certain area by highlighting it, however when I do that the problem just moves to a different bit of text.
I used to get this problem now and then after updating firefox with firefox running, but it always resolved itself after closing and re-opening firefox, however this is not the case this time.
